Default Our Punta Cana trip Dec. 2007

Our first night we stayed at the Carabela Resort and it was a very nice resort! My husband & neighbors both said they'd stay here for a week, it was that nice. Then the next 7 days were at Melia Caribe Tropical Resort. What a beautiful resort! The Buffet near the check in was the best of all of them. We ate all of our breakfasts in Betty's Kitchen (buffet) and there's many items that were luke warm to cold. So if you go there in the AM, get in line to order an omelet, you pick out your own ingredients and they prepare it right there for you. You do have to make dinner reservations the night before, starting at 9 PM. The Japanese was good but after dinner, you had to be moved to another table for dessert, as they only had 2 large tables for dinner. The Capri restaurant is very noisy! The music is loud, and you have to talk even louder to hear each other. Out of 7 dinners, that was the worst one for us. For lunch, they had a BBQ going on down by the beach, great food there, burgers, chicken, pork, french fries (they were hot and fresh). The maids were not that great. We'd leave notes every day for what we needed and many times it wouldn't happen! My husband brought baseball items to trade with the vendors down from the resort. We stopped into a thrift store before leaving for PC, picked up kids gloves, baseballs, baseball cards. They love those items and will make a good trade with you. I bought make up from the dollar store for the maid, and one time she left a bottle of rum and some fruit for us, after about 3 days of leaving this and a tip. The vendors down from the resort are extremely pushy and bothersome! We found detours to get around them so we didn't have to walk right by them because they would all approach you, one after another, very annoying! The trains that take you around the resort, have nasty exhaust fumes, that was the only bad thing about those. IF you see someone driving a golf cart, offer him a dollar or two and he'll gladly give you a ride, it's much faster and not as stinky. It was an awesome trip, the ocean is gorgeous, warm water, the resort is beautiful, and we would definitely go back. No place is perfect, but I know they are trying very hard to be, and they're well on their way!

Default The Bars at Melia

The service was great, at the swim up bar, and also the bar near the lobby, with our waitress Isabella. She was awesome, and almost like a daughter to us. When you tip on a daily basis, they usually wait on you first, even if you're not first in line! Watch out for the wine though. I had some with dinner and I'm uncertain of the alcohol content, but I was alittle "green" the next day!!

It is a rare day that the sun is not shining in Punta Cana. If there is a shower, it is usually in the evening and short.
